This coverage focuses on Blue Cross, a leading UK animal welfare charity, and its work within the wider petcare sector. Pet Gazette reports on Blue Crossโ€™s rehoming initiatives, veterinary services, community outreach programmes, and partnerships with retailers, distributors, and industry organisations. Our coverage provides pet trade professionals with insights into the charityโ€™s impact on animal welfare, opportunities for collaboration, and its role in promoting responsible pet ownership across the UK.
